AMD launches new Triple and Quad Core Chips
AMD have launched all new multi-core Phenom desktop processing chips. The new Phenom processors include the X4 9000 series quad-core and X3 8000 series triple-core (worlds first) processors.

Blu-ray Disc Copy-Protection Cracked
Blu-ray disc copy-protection has been cracked again by SlySoft, a company that is well known for producing “ripper” and cloning software.

Windows Mobile to use Flash Lite (for the moment)
Microsoft have licensed Flash Lite for its Windows Mobile operating systems. In an agreement with Adobe it seems that the OS will now be supporting both Microsoft’s Silverlight and Flash Lite. Silverlight for mobile isn’t ready yet and analysts are expecting it by the end of the second quarter.

AOL pays $850 Million for Bebo
AOL have announced their intention to acquired Bebo, one of the popular social media networks, for a reported $850m. The news has caught many analysts off-guard as there has been speculations in the past weeks that TimeWarner may be planning to flog off AOL to the highest bidder.
